Title: Bus Pirate v4 LCD adapter v2a Free Pcb
Post by: cosminnci on February 04, 2012, 08:48:44 am
This is the Bus Pirate v4 LCD adapter v2a from the pcb drawer
I had a little problem with the power supply, the vcc on the pcb is connected to 3.3v, I cut the trace and connected to the 5V
The lcd I tested is 2x16
